The objective of the Elysian Level 2 Award in Autism and Animals is to: 

- Equip you with foundational knowledge and practical skills to work effectively with children, young people, and adults on the autism spectrum, using animals to support their development and wellbeing. 

By the end of this course, you will understand the characteristics of autism and how animals can play a role in therapeutic and educational settings to support individuals with autism.

Elysian delivers high quality education and animal assisted therapy across our sites. We believe that our clients gain a huge degree of positive reward from working with our animals and we aim to increase the awareness and integration of carefully planned animal work wherever it could benefit people and help them overcome any barriers they are experiencing. Our animal welfare is a priority for our staff and sessions are developed to meet the needs of clients while protecting the animals used.
We offer a level 5 diploma in Animal Assisted Interventions for professionals looking to bring animal sessions into their therapeutic settings.
